Output e664d930076a4eedc0e747389e7d9669c78f8d832657b123d0e363d3b83c9555:0

value
527766
script pubkey
OP_0 OP_PUSHBYTES_20 c9bf8c46bbd92e9c072e3ceeb40770b677af321f
address
bc1qexlcc34mmyhfcpew8nhtgpmskem67vslt3nl8t
transaction
e664d930076a4eedc0e747389e7d9669c78f8d832657b123d0e363d3b83c9555